Two Remanded For Gang-Raping 12-year-old Girl in Ilorin

Date: 2019-01-19

An Ilorin Magistrate's court has remanded Tosin Fagbemi, 25,and Majeed Babatunde, 40, for allegedly gang raping a 12- years- old girl at Osere area of Ilorin, the Kwara state capital Their accomplice simply identified as Tunde, is presently at large.

Fagbemi and Babatunde were charged for criminal conspiracy and unlawful sexual intercourse with a child, contrary to section 96 of penal code law and section 31 (1), (2) & (3) of Kwara State Child's Rights Law 2006 .

Babatunde was not, however, in court as he was said to be receiving treatment in a hospital due to the treatment melted on him by the angry mob which apprehended him. The Police First Information Report (FIR) revealed that the mother of the victim reported the matter to the Police before it was referred to Anti-Human Trafficking, Women and Children Protection unit for secret investigation. The Police report noted that the complainant who resides at Osere area, Ilorin reported that on 7th January, 2019, her daughter was attacked while going home by the second accused, Fagbemi who also resides in the same address.

According to the FIR, Fagbemi took the girl to a room where the first accused , Babatunde and Tunde whose surname and address is still unknown forcefully had sexual intercourse with her. In the course of the investigation, Babatunde confessed to the crime and being the only one who had canal knowledge of the girl. The prosecutor, Sgt. Oderinde Abideen informed the court that the offence preferred against the accused is not ordinarily bailable. He also urged the court to remand the accused pending the time police investigation will be completed on the matter.

On his part, counsel to the accused , A.Y Sulyman informed the court that he will come formally for bail application of his client. Magistrate Esther Kikelomo Abu in her short ruling refused to take oral application from the accused person's counsel. She ordered that the suspects be remanded in prison custody and adjourned the matter to 29th January 29 .
